Nutrient Comparison: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t VS Red Sweet Peppers per 7 oz
Compare the macro and micronutrient content in 7 oz of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t versus 7 oz of Red Sweet Peppers to make informed dietary choices. Explore their nutritional differences and benefits.
Lets compare vitamin content per 7 ounces of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t vs Red Sweet Peppers:
- 7 ounces of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t have 3.9 times more Vitamin A and 2 times more Vitamin K than Red Sweet Peppers.
- While 7 oz of Raw Red Sweet Peppers contain 2.8 times more Vitamin B1, 3.1 times more Vitamin B2, 2.3 times more Vitamin B3, 2.3 times more Vitamin B5, 2.6 times more Vitamin B6, 5.8 times more Vitamin B9, 63.9 times more Vitamin C and 2.2 times more Vitamin E than Canned Carrots Solids and Liquids with Salt.
- 7 ounces of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B1
- Both Canned Carrots Solids and Liquids with Salt as well as Raw Red Sweet Peppers have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in seven ounces.
Comparing minerals per 7 ounces for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t vs Red Sweet Peppers:
- 7 ounces of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t have 4.4 times more Calcium, 6.1 times more Copper, 1.2 times more Iron, 4 times more Manganese and 60 times more Sodium than Red Sweet Peppers.
- While 7 oz of Raw Red Sweet Peppers contain 1.3 times more Magnesium and 1.3 times more Phosphorus than Canned Carrots Solids and Liquids with Salt.
- Both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t and Red Sweet Peppers contain similar levels of Potassium, Zinc and Water per seven ounces.
- 7 ounces of Red Sweet Peppers lack sufficient amounts of Calcium and Copper
- Both Canned Carrots Solids and Liquids with Salt as well as Raw Red Sweet Peppers lack sufficient amounts of Selenium in seven ounces.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 7 ounces:
- 7 oz of Raw Red Sweet Peppers contain 7 times more Omega 3 and 1.7 times more Sugars than Canned Carrots Solids and Liquids with Salt.
- Both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t and Red Sweet Peppers offer comparable quantities of Carbohydrate and Fiber per seven ounces.
- 7 ounces of Canned Carrots with Liquids and Salt prov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3
- Both Canned Carrots Solids and Liquids with Salt as well as Raw Red Sweet Peppers provide inadequate amounts of Energy, Omega 6 and Protein in seven ounces.
